Supercomputer Center Adds Windows HPC Server to 1,200-Node Cluster Options

Overview To meet the new and expanding needs of its academic and industrial users, the National Center for Supercomputing Applications (NCSA) at the University of Illinois must support the platforms with which those users are familiar, which means offering more than just Linux-based High-Performance Computing (HPC) resources. NCSA achieved that goal by deploying Windows HPC Server 2008 on the center's 1,200-node HPC cluster.
